Continue to eat well. Made our favorite roast chicken (adapted from Marcella Hazan's Essential Italian Cooking - or known as The Bible in this household)

Brine the chicken in water, kosher salt, sugar & bay leaf

Rub the chicken with olive oil, kosher salt, Joe's stuff, paprika, cumin, cloves, nutmeg, connamon and cracked pepper

Stuff the chicken with whole lemon (with holes pricked in them), rosemary & sage

Roast in the oven at 325 degrees, 20 minutes per pound. Do not turn. Do not open the oven during cooking time.

When it's done, let chicken cool for 5 - 10 minutes before carving. Make gravy with white wine, roux, sage and shallots.

Served with roasted sweet potatoes (rubbed with olive oil & kosher salt) and sauteed oyster mushrooms.
